ARF rooms approved for non-ambulatory residents can be used for __________________________
residents. 80010(b)(1)
Non-ambulatory and ambulatory
ARF licensees shall reveal what in each or all advertisements, publications, or announcements made
with the intent to attract residents? 80011(A)(1)(a)
License number
Disaster drills shall be conducted in ARF homes at least once ___________________________. 80023(d)
Every 6 months
What must licensees do when they change the conditions or limitations described on their license, such
as location or capacity?
File a new licensing application
A follow-up visit shall be conducted to determine compliance with the plan of correction specified in the
notice of deficiency within __________________________ unless the licensee has demonstrated by
some other means that the deficiency was corrected as required. 80053(a)(1)
10 working days
What is the timeline for an ARF to report a special incident to Community Care Licensing by fax or
telephone? 80061(b)
By the next working day during CCL's normal business hours
The licensee has ___________________________ days to mail a Special Incident Report to Community
Care Licensing? 80061(b)
7 days
How long does the licensee have to report a change of their CEO or Licensee's mailing address? 80061(c)
(2)(3)
10 working days
How long does the licensee have to report a change in the ARF's plan of operation? 80061(c)(4)
10 working days
Who can change the label on a prescribed medication? 80071(n)(4)
Nobody but the dispensing pharmacist.
Centrally stored medication records must be maintained for how long? 80075(N)(7)
, 1 year
An ARF administrator shall be at least how old? 85064(c), 85964.2(B)(3)(b)
21
What are the education requirements for an administrator of a 8-bed ARF? 85064(d)
High school diploma or GED
An ARF certificate holder who wants to administer a home for 50 residents shall meet what
requirements prior to employment as an administrator? 85064(i)(1)(2)
High school diploma or GED and completion of 60 college units OR 4 years of work experience in
residential care
How many hours per week must an administrator be available to work in each care home he/she
administers? 85064(d)(1)
The number of hours necessary to manage and administer the facility in compliance with applicable law
and regulation
When an administrator is absent from the facility, what are the coverage requirements" 85064(f)
Coverage by a designated substitute who is capable of running the home and who meets the
qualifications listed in section 80065
What are the three things a person must do to become a certified administrator? 85064(B)(1)(2)(3)(d)
Complete the initial training class, pass a written exam, submit an application form along with a
processing fee of $100
An administrator must pass a written exam administered by ACS within ____________ days of
completing the initial certification program? 85064.3(b)(2)
60 days
An administrator must submit an application form to ACS within ____________ of being notified of
having passed the ARF administrator exam?
30 days
The amount of the ARF administrator certification processing fee is? 85064(b)(3)(d)
$100
ARF administrator certificates must be renewed every ______________. 85064.2(e)
2 years
in order for an ARF administrator to renew their certificate the certificate holder shall submit a written
application or letter to the _____________________ located in Sacramento. 85064.3
CCL Administrator Certification Section (ACS)
